The first episode of “Derlish Ertugrul” caused a stir

The long wait of millions of Pakistani drama fans is over and the drama ‘Derelish Ertugrul’, also known as Ertugrul Ghazi, based on the Turkish city of Afaq Islamic conquests, was aired on Pakistan Television (PTV).

The drama was aired on PTV from the 1st of Ramadan and the first episode was aired before 8 pm.

“Derelish Ertugrul” was watched by millions of users in cities and villages on PTV, while surprisingly, the said drama has also been watched by more than 3 million people on PTV’s YouTube channel so far.

While millions of drama fans waited for the release of “Derelish Ertugrul”, the popularity of PTV has also increased and 40,000 new subscribers have subscribed to PTV’s YouTube channel in a single day.

Prime Minister Imran Khan also issued a special message on the occasion of airing “Derelish Ertugrul” on PTV and termed Turkish drama as close to not only Islamic but also Pakistani culture and history.

Expressing happiness over the airing of ‘Derelish Ertugrul’ in his special video, Prime Minister Imran Khan said that it was necessary to air the drama based on the history of Islamic conquests on PTV so that the new generation of Pakistan Relate to your history.

The Prime Minister said that the new generation of Pakistanis was stuck in nudity from Hollywood to Bollywood and then Bollywood, so it is good to broadcast dramas like ‘Derelish Ertugrul’.

According to the Prime Minister, until 40 years ago, there was not as much nudity in Bollywood as there is today.

Apart from the Prime Minister, several important personalities also expressed their sentiments on the occasion of airing ‘Derelish Ertugrul’ on PTV and on April 25, the hashtag ‘Ertugrul in Urdu’ also became a top trend on Twitter.

It should be noted that this play is also called the “Game of Thrones” of Turkey and this play is very important in terms of Islamic conquests in the 13th century.

The story of Derelish Ertugrul’s play predates the rise of the Ottoman Empire in the 13th century and revolves around a brave Muslim general named Ertugrul, also known as Ertugrul Ghazi.

The play shows how in the 13th century the Turkish general Ertugrul bravely fought the Mongols, the Crusaders and the oppressors and maintained his winning streak.

The play depicts Ertugrul’s pre-Ottoman rule, bravery and love.

The drama has already been aired in 60 countries in different languages ​​before it was presented in Urdu in Pakistan.

The drama is based on five seasons and a total of 179 episodes. The drama was initially aired on TRT in 2014 and is now available on other online streaming channels, including Netflix.
